Unqualified staff found mixing cancer drugs at HCG

AN internal audit committee commissioned to assess the quality of clinical research at HCG Hospital found that a phlebotomist—someone trained only to draw blood—was assigned the role of an "unblinded staff member" responsible for managing and mixing investigational cancer drugs in a clinical trial.

- RISHITA KHANNA @Bengaluru

This serious breach of protocol, which requires a qualified pharmacist for any drug preparation, was among several alarming lapses flagged in the audit.

The review, sources told TNIE, came to an abrupt halt after auditors were asked to stop midway by site staff, reportedly on the instructions of Dr. Sathish CT, Director of Clinical Trials at HCG. The audit was conducted by Quinary Clinical Research between February 12 and 22, 2023, with the objective of checking the functioning of HCG's Institutional Ethics Committee (IEC) and reviewing trial-specific processes, but its findings never came to light publicly until now—surfacing amid renewed scrutiny of HCG this year.
